The Vertebrate Alternative Splicing and Transcription Database (VastDB) is the largest resource of genome-wide, quantitative profiles of AS events assembled to date. VastDB provides readily accessible quantitative information on the inclusion levels and functional associations of AS events detected in RNA-seq data from diverse vertebrate cell and tissue types, as well as developmental stages.
Read the paper in Genome Research.
